news 2026/5/1 8:15:05

‌测试文档轻量化: balancing 敏捷协作与知识沉淀‌

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
‌测试文档轻量化: balancing 敏捷协作与知识沉淀‌

测试文档的轻量化挑战

在敏捷开发浪潮中,软件测试从业者常面临两难困境:一方面,敏捷原则(如Scrum或Kanban)强调快速迭代和团队协作,要求测试文档精简高效以加速反馈;另一方面,知识沉淀(如测试用例、缺陷报告和流程记录)是确保软件质量长期可追溯的关键。轻量化测试文档并非简单删减,而是通过结构化、自动化和协作化手段,在"快"与"稳"之间找到平衡点。本文将探讨轻量化的核心原则、实施策略及工具应用,帮助测试团队提升效率同时避免知识流失。

第一部分:测试文档轻量化的定义与必要性

测试文档轻量化是指在保持文档核心价值的前提下,通过减少冗余、优化格式和增强互动性,使文档更易于创建、共享和维护。其必要性源于敏捷测试的三大痛点:

  1. 协作效率瓶颈:传统测试文档(如Word或Excel格式的测试计划)往往冗长静态,导致评审耗时、更新滞后。例如,在Sprint迭代中,测试用例文档若需多轮邮件审核,会拖慢开发节奏。

  2. 知识沉淀风险:过度追求敏捷可能忽视文档积累,新成员入职或Bug复现时,缺乏历史记录会增加学习曲线和错误率。研究显示,40%的软件缺陷源于知识断层(来源:IEEE测试报告)。

  3. 规模与复杂度矛盾:大型项目(如金融或医疗系统)测试文档动辄数百页,但敏捷要求"刚刚好"的文档量——既能指导测试执行,又不阻碍变更响应。

轻量化不是弱化文档,而是重构其形式:从"重量级报告"转向"轻量级活文档",以Markdown、Wiki或嵌入式注释等格式为主,确保实时可编辑和版本可控。目标是在敏捷协作(如每日站会快速决策)与知识沉淀(如构建测试知识库)间建立动态平衡。

第二部分:平衡策略:从理论到实践

实现轻量化需结合方法论、工具和团队文化,以下是核心策略及案例:

  • 策略1:结构化最小可行文档(MVD)
    聚焦关键元素:测试计划简化为单页大纲(含目标、范围、风险),测试用例用行为驱动开发(BDD)格式(如Gherkin语法:"Given-When-Then"),确保简洁可执行。案例:某电商团队用Confluence模板将测试用例文档从50页减至10页,评审时间缩短60%,同时通过标签系统链接缺陷(JIRA集成),提升知识追溯性。

  • 策略2:自动化与智能化辅助
    利用工具减少人工负担:自动化生成测试报告(如Selenium + Allure框架),或AI辅助文档摘要(如ChatGPT提炼会议记录)。在持续集成(CI)流水线嵌入文档更新,例如Jenkins触发测试结果自动同步到Wiki。实践建议:优先自动化高频、重复任务(如回归测试日志),人力专注于创新性测试设计。

  • 策略3:协作式知识管理
    将文档融入团队工作流:使用共享平台(如Notion或GitHub Wiki)实现实时协作,设置文档"负责人"轮值制度。鼓励"文档即代码"文化——测试脚本(Python/Java)内嵌注释说明,版本控制(Git)记录变更历史。案例:某FinTech公司通过Slack集成测试文档机器人,Sprint期间实时问答,沉淀高频问题到知识库,缺陷复现率下降30%。

  • 权衡机制:敏捷与沉淀的黄金分割
    建立度量指标:如"文档更新频率"(敏捷指标) vs. "知识复用率"(沉淀指标)。通过回顾会调整平衡:例如,若新成员上手慢,强化用例模板;若迭代延迟,简化评审流程。注意避免极端:过度轻量化致知识黑洞,或过度文档化拖累速度。

第三部分:实施路径与未来展望

启动轻量化需分步走:先诊断现状(审计现有文档痛点),再试点小范围(如一个Sprint团队),最终全流程推广。关键成功因素:

  • 工具链整合:推荐JIRA(任务管理)+ Confluence(文档协作)+ Zephyr(测试用例)生态,支持Markdown导出/导入。

  • 团队培训:举办工作坊培养"轻量文档思维",强调文档是协作工具而非官僚负担。

  • 持续改进:每季度评估平衡效果,利用反馈循环优化。

未来,AI和低代码工具将重塑轻量化:预测性文档生成(基于历史数据)和可视化知识图谱可进一步解放测试人力。但核心不变——平衡的艺术在于,让文档像敏捷一样流动,如知识一样沉淀。测试从业者应拥抱变革:轻量化不是终点,而是持续优化的旅程,助力团队在高速迭代中筑起质量长城。

结语

测试文档轻量化是敏捷时代的必备技能,它解耦了速度与质量的矛盾。通过结构化精简、自动化赋能和协作深化,测试团队能实现"快而不乱,稳而不僵"。记住:最好的文档不是最厚的,而是最活的——它呼吸着团队智慧,驱动着软件卓越。

精选文章

智能测试的并行化策略:加速高质量软件交付

契约测试:破解微服务集成测试困境的利器

智能IDE的测试集成:重塑软件质量保障新范式

可解释人工智能在软件测试中的实践与展望

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/1 6:44:48

测试人员赋能开发:共建自动化测试与质量门禁

被低估的测试价值 在DevOps持续交付的浪潮中,测试团队常陷入"质量守门人"的被动定位。2025年《全球软件质量报告》显示:73%的团队因测试瓶颈导致发布延迟,而自动化测试覆盖率超过70%的项目交付效率提升40%。数据印证了测试角色的战…

作者头像 李华
网站建设 2026/4/30 15:47:25

YOLOFuse与HTML结合展示结果:构建本地检测演示页

YOLOFuse与HTML结合展示结果:构建本地检测演示页 在夜间监控、工业巡检或无人系统感知的开发过程中,一个常见的难题摆在面前:如何让复杂的多模态AI模型输出变得“看得见、讲得清”?尤其是在低光照环境下,单靠可见光图像…

作者头像 李华
网站建设 2026/4/27 14:41:51

YOLOFuse mathtype公式居中对齐段落文本

YOLOFuse:基于Ultralytics的多模态目标检测技术解析 在夜间监控、自动驾驶或工业巡检等现实场景中,单一可见光摄像头常常“力不从心”——低光照下图像模糊,烟雾弥漫时目标难辨。而红外成像虽能穿透黑暗与遮挡,却缺乏纹理细节和颜…

作者头像 李华
网站建设 2026/4/22 14:55:57

YOLOFuse训练自定义数据集指南:双通道图像配对上传规范

YOLOFuse训练自定义数据集指南:双通道图像配对上传规范 在智能安防、自动驾驶和夜间监控等场景中,单一可见光视觉系统常常在低光照或恶劣天气下“失明”。而红外成像虽能穿透黑暗,却缺乏纹理细节。如何让模型“既看得见热源,又认得…

作者头像 李华
网站建设 2026/5/1 6:44:19

Token用量计算器上线:预估每张照片消耗的计算资源

Token用量计算器上线:预估每张照片消耗的计算资源 在AI图像处理逐渐走进千家万户的今天,老照片修复早已不再是专业修图师的专属领域。越来越多用户希望通过一键操作,让泛黄模糊的黑白影像重获生动色彩。然而,一个现实问题始终存在…

作者头像 李华
网站建设 2026/5/1 5:41:51

YOLOFuse推理结果在哪看?/runs/predict/exp路径全解析

YOLOFuse推理结果在哪看?/runs/predict/exp路径全解析 在智能安防、自动驾驶和工业质检等实际场景中,单靠可见光图像进行目标检测往往力不从心。夜晚的低光照、火灾现场的浓烟、强反光环境下的遮挡……这些问题让传统RGB摄像头频频“失明”。而红外&…

作者头像 李华